39 Days from Cincinnati to Philadelphia
An Ohio Miller's 1838 Journal
39 Days from Cincinnati to Philadelphia by Tracy Lawson is a first-person narrative that covers a two-month journey across five states. Henry Rogers, his wife, and her parents traveled from Cincinatti, OH, to Philadelpha, PA, then on to Trenton, NJ, in the summer and fall of 1838. Henry's daily journal entries vividly decribe his changing surroundings, and his observations about politics, commerce, agriculture, tourist attractions, new technology, and the natural landscape through which he was traveling.
Tracy Lawson and her eight-year-old daughter drove the same route 165 years later following the same path traveled by her great-great-great grandfather. Using a camera and daily journal to document their own experiences, they compared their visit and observations with those of Henry.

Gullah and Geechee
The Journey from 17th-Century Africa to 21st-Century AmericaGullah and Geechee by Cynthia Porcher provides a broad history of these people of the Lowcountry from late 17th century Africa to 21st century America. Whenever possible, the author includes personal accounts of oral histories given to her during her research. The book is a synopsis of this rich cultural history that will be a valued resource for communities, a tool for preservation and fundraising, a source of pride for Gullah/Geechee people, a textbook for students, and can be read and enjoyed by everyone.
